Description:

This interview delves into Regina Spektor's musical journey, from her classical upbringing in Moscow to her emergence as a unique singer-songwriter in New York's anti-folk scene. Spektor reflects on her early inspirations, including classical music, The Beatles, and Russian bard singers, and shares how she transitioned into songwriting at age 17. She discusses her experiences touring with The Strokes and Kings of Leon, emphasizing the educational and life-changing aspects of these tours and expressing gratitude for their support. Looking ahead, Spektor aims to release a new record, find a supportive label, and expand her musical collaborations while continuing to grow as an artist.
